Lake Wind Advisory
Statement as of 11:12 AM CST on January 06, 2009
... Lake Wind Advisory in effect until 9 PM CST this evening...
The National Weather Service in Birmingham has issued a lake Wind
Advisory... which is in effect until 9 PM CST this evening.
Winds will frequently gust over 25 mph across the area this
afternoon and early evening.
A lake Wind Advisory indicates that winds will cause rough chop
on area lakes. Small boats will be especially prone to capsizing.

- High Wind Advisory
A high wind advisory is issued when sustained winds of 31 mph or greater are expected to occur for at least 1 hour. This advisory can also be issued if winds of 46 mph or greater are expected for any length of time.
